Output 80436cb124bb1ba67e728454272028f27ef6278d8e30c6724b67dd9297b78509:3

value
1037875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ece4be8ca94d51bc95fde404193f9b29cff248d1 OP_EQUALVERIFY OP_CHECKSIG
address
1NbaVi16H2MXdg53LTs1zFhBAid5AchZGe
transaction
80436cb124bb1ba67e728454272028f27ef6278d8e30c6724b67dd9297b78509
spent
true